Millie is a large, black, female German Shepherd Dog/Labrador Retriever mix currently at SNARR Northeast. She is a senior who is spayed, house trained, and weighs around 68 pounds. Her vaccinations are up to date, and she gets along well with children and other dogs. Millie would do best in a cat-free home.

  • What type of living environment is this breed usually best suited for?

    German Shepherd Dog/Labrador Retriever mixes thrive in active households with ample space to play and exercise. They do well in homes with yards or in environments where they get regular physical activity.

  • How much outdoor space does this breed typically need?

    This mix generally benefits from a yard or regular access to parks. Daily walks, playtime, and outdoor activities are essential for their well-being.

  • Is this breed typically suitable for homes with children?

    German Shepherd and Labrador mixes are known to be friendly and gentle with children, making them great family pets when properly socialized.
